Anyway, BBIG was very clean, very well kept, and very spacious, even for the 6 of us(only my buddy and I knew each other) who stayed there during my 3 nights. Probably a 10 minute walk to the Cornilia metro stop in 1 direction, another 10 minute walk in the other direction to a taxi stand, and bus stops all along Via Gregorio. Great pizza shops within walking distance, all in the very nice neighborhood surrounding BBIG. And a laundromat. Which came up huge when we arrived. If there is any downside, it's not about BBIG itself, it's just that where it is...is not really central to the "action" of Rome. But if you want to stay in a nice, quiet neighborhood, then this is the place to stay(not sure why everyone is complaining about street noise...if you're a proper tourist in Rome, you come back here and just pass right out and sleep through everything!!)
